Hi There My name is Larry Beach (aka Orion61)... probably the only "Son of a Beach" you will hear from today.
I just ran across this site when looking for "shorty" mufflers for my '75 stock 650.
I cut my teeth with Yamaha in the 70's with my first bike a 100 Twin, Blue and White.
Man I put a lot of miles on that thing! It would blow a Kawasaki 100 away off the line but not in the top end.
This sold me on Low end Torque and drive ability.
BTW I was WAAAY too young to drive it, Legally but I lived on a Farm so I had a Million open miles of dirt road.
Since I learned to ride on Gravel, pavement driving was a snap. Even today 4" of fresh gravel doesn't even phase me, just go with it and don't fight it too much!:eek:
I bought my First 650 a 73' when I saw it sitting on the side of the road for sale.
I have always been a Horse Trader so a Mossberg Shotgun out of my collection and I owned it.
MAN I fell in love with it.
It had been rode hard and put up wet, it only had 12k on it but I don't think the oil had ever been changed, or it ever saw an indoor Winter!
The filter was plugged up and a hole had worn into it. I rode it for 2 years. Holy Cow I loved that Sapphire Sparkle Blue!
BTW I have found a very close match in a Powder coat for it if you need it, PM Me.
Driving down the road one day, I was cruising along when the motor lugged, 3 seconds later before I knew it the rear wheel was locked..
Seems the previous owner tightened the cam chain tension WAAAY down and it ground off the tension head and froze up the cam... I bought a Honda CB 550, that HIDEOUS burned Orange.. even worse it had a matching fairing... I couldn't wait to get rid of it! It was smooth but a Dog for Torque
I wanted another 650. I traded it for another 73' this one was MINT! I put on 4" over forks on it, it had 6" over and I could hardly touch the ground (tippy toes)and I am 6'1" tall.
I found a Chrome German Cross Sissy Bar and Chrome Spike pegs for the front.
Rode it to the New Mall to see a Movie, came out and it was GONE! never to be seen again.. I still miss that bike, lots of custom Chrome!
The next used oil but was all I could afford, still rode it to over 40k miles..
after that there was a Yellow beauty that had no low end torque, never did figure that out.
There were a few more here and there owning a couple at a time.
I even overhauled a TX750, If you know how to tune them and keep the counter Balance chain the correct tension they are a really nice hifhway bike.
I found my current Bike when I wasn't looking for one. I stopped by Viking Sports looking for a part and I saw it, a trade in a couple days earlier from the Orig. owner a Dr
that babied it, never parked it outside. One issue, a flasher dimple in the gas tank.
That is how I got it, he bought a used CB350 he could handle :bike:putter, putter...
That was 30 years ago.. I got hurt at work and she has been sitting for a few years,
"clean stored" This year she will see the road again!
The Girlfriend made a comment about parking it outside, because it was taking too much room in the garage.. I told her I'd move it, but I'd be selling the Queen size bed, replacing it with a single and My 650 would have HER side of the bedroom:yikes:
I've had the XS for 30 her for 5..
The Bike is still in the Garage. Funny she backed right down....:D
